Can 2 rectangles with the same perimeter have different areas?

Rectangles that measure 8 × 2 and 5 × 5 have the same perimeter (20) but different areas. An increase in area is connected to an increase in the minimum perimeter. The quadrilateral with the smallest perimeter for a given area is a square. and a = 2(1+ r) r .

Is the plane closed curve of fixed perimeter and maximum area?

Isoperimetric problem, in mathematics, the determination of the shape of the closed plane curve having a given length and enclosing the maximum area. (In the absence of any restriction on shape, the curve is a circle.)

Can a triangle have more than one area?

A triangle with a fixed perimeter can have many different areas . Try this Drag the orange dot on the triangle below. The triangle will have a fixed perimeter, but the area will vary. A common error is to assume that a triangle that has a fixed perimeter must also have a fixed area.
